Supabase Raises $100M at $5B Valuation, Co-Led by Accel and Peak XV

Top backend for AI-driven development will use new funding to serve the most data-intensive enterprises

SAN FRANCISCO, Oct. 3,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Supabase, the Postgres development platform, has raised $100 million in Series E funding at a $5 billion valuation. The round was led by Accel and Peak XV with participation from Figma Ventures and other returning investors, underscoring strong confidence in the company’s growth. The round comes just four months after their Series D, bringing their total funding to over $500 million.

As part of the Series E funding, Supabase intends to reserve an allocation for its community members to co-invest alongside institutional partners. This initiative reflects the founders’ commitment to community, and will provide an opportunity for open source advocates to participate directly in the company’s growth.

“Our community is what makes Supabase special, and it’s a priority to give them the opportunity to co-invest in what we’re building,” said Paul Copplestone, co-founder and CEO of Supabase. “With the new capital we’ll continue serving our community of over 4 million developers while building open source tools to scale Postgres.”

This round marks what has been a banner year for Supabase, emerging as the preferred backend for AI-driven development. Platforms like Lovable and Bolt run on Supabase, alongside more than 100,000 customers; from over 50% of the latest Y Combinator batch, to enterprises such as PwC, McDonald’s, and Github Next.

Over 4 million developers choose to use Supabase, often alongside Cursor and Claude Code, because it allows them to quickly spin up a backend that instantly updates itself with commands from AI.

The new capital will accelerate Supabase’s work on “Multigres”, an enterprise-scale version of its platform designed for large, data-intensive applications. To lead the effort, Supabase has hired Sugu Sougoumarane, the co-creator of Vitess. Sougoumarane is among a growing list of industry-leading database and open source founders working at Supabase; including Postgres core contributors, the NGINX co-founder, and the founders of various Y Combinator companies.
